John purchases a car for $18,500. The value of the car depreciates by 11% per year. What is the approximate value of the car after 8 years?

$2,035

$2,313

$7,283

$16,465

A used bookstore sells hardback books and paperback books.

A hardback book costs $18, including tax.

A paperback book costs $8, including tax.

Cameron bought 3 more paperback books than hardback books.

Cameron spent $154.  

How many paperback books did Cam buy?

5

6

7

8

Jamison works at a car dealership where he earns $600 each week plus a commission equal to 1% of his total sales. This week his goal is to earn at least $1,000. What is the minimum amount of total sales Jamison must have to reach his goal?

$80,000

$50,000

$35,000

$40,000
